The Definition of 3D Tattoos

Imagine a two-dimensional image transforming into a vibrant existence. A proficient artist manipulates shading, highlights, and negative space to deceive your perception into perceiving a three-dimensional object or a 3D tattoo idea with depth. The key lies in skillfully manipulating light and shadow to achieve a lifelike, three-dimensional illusion.

History Of 3D Tattoos

Although the trend of 3D tattoos has gained significant popularity in recent times, the underlying concept is not entirely novel. Traditional Japanese tattoo styles such as Tebori have long utilized techniques involving layering and shading to create an illusion of depth. However, the increasing dominance of social media and the continual drive to push artistic limits have undeniably catapulted 3D tattoos into the center of attention.

3D Tattoo Techniques

Curious about how artists accomplish this captivating effect? Here’s a glimpse into the process:

  • Shading & Color Saturation

Shading and color saturation revolve around the principles of light and shadow. Through deliberate placement of highlights and darker shades, the artist skillfully crafts the impression of curves and dimension. Additionally, color saturation contributes to this effect as vivid hues are employed for objects in the foreground, while subdued tones are chosen for the background, further enriching the three-dimensional aspect.

  • Negative Space

The vacant area surrounding your tattoo artwork holds equal significance as the artwork itself. Through adept manipulation of the negative space, the artist can produce the optical illusion of objects protruding from your skin.

Things to Consider Before Getting a 3D Tattoos

Before committing, it is important to keep in mind a few considerations about 3D tattoos, which are unquestionably captivating.

  • Pain: To be frank, getting tattoos is not a simple and painless experience. When it comes to 3D tattoos, with their intricate designs and multiple layers of shading, the process can be lengthier and more uncomfortable compared to conventional tattoos. It’s important to mentally and physically prepare yourself!
  • Locating the Ideal Artist: This step is of utmost importance! Not every tattoo artist possesses the expertise or confidence to proficiently craft 3D illusions. Conduct thorough research, thoroughly examine portfolios, and identify an artist who specializes in the field of 3D artwork and whose artistic style aligns with your personal preferences.
  • Price: Owing to the intricate craftsmanship and time required, 3D tattoos typically entail a higher cost compared to conventional tattoos. It is advisable to be financially ready to procure enduring and exemplary artwork.
  • Maintenance: Just like with any tattoo, it is essential to follow the appropriate aftercare procedures to preserve the vividness and intricate 3D tattoo designs. It is crucial to carefully adhere to the instructions provided by your tattoo artist and prioritize sun protection.
  • Fading and Aging: As time passes, the vibrancy of all tattoos diminishes. In the case of 3D tattoos, the intricate elements may lose their distinctiveness as the ink ages. It is advisable to have a conversation with your artist regarding potential touch-up alternatives before getting the tattoo.
